A custom high-pressure cuvette system was developed, capable of operating at pressures up to 110 MPa to investigate pressure-dependent effects on enzymatic activity and biogeochemical element cycling in the deep ocean. This system features three sapphire windows for real-time absorption and fluorescence measurements, as well as temperature control. This dataset contains the maximum-normalized fluorescence measurements obtained using this system, for assessing the enzymatic activity of extracellular chitinase produced by a piezo-sensitive Vibrio anguillarum (PF430-3, originally isolated in Chile) strain. Specifically, the dataset includes excitation-emission matrices (EEMs) for the substrate 4-MUF-NAG, the fluorophore 4-MUF and the combined signal from 4-MUF-NAG in 30% medium along with cleaved 4-MUF in the presence of chitinase enzymes.
